Hey — handover before I'm out. Tracing across the Lanternfish microservices runs through the Spanline collector; config is in the infra repo. Watch the sampling rate, 10% max or storage blows up. Dashboards are self-explanatory. To get admin on the Spanline console you'll need the shared recovery passphrase, which is below.

strongbox words: fraath-ulaax

Hi Tomas,

Welcome aboard. Main open item is the Ferrowyn Plastics contract — renewal talks stalled over volume discounts. Their rep is reasonable but slow; keep chasing. Draft terms are in the contracts drive, marked v4. Aim to close before the quarter turns. One sensitive point for your eyes only below.

confidential, yaweg-bafog: The western region missed its Druael quota by 42.1 percent last quarter. Wenokix Group plans to raise the Alddor list price by 36.3 percent in June. The finance team signed off on a budget of $272.6 million for Project Rusax. The renewal with Istiusix Systems closes at $334.2 million a year, 62.9 percent below the last contract.

Action item: The Relayn deploy-status bot silently dropped updates when the pipeline API paginated results, so responders believed a rollback had completed when it had not. We will add pagination handling, a staleness banner, and an integration test. Until merged, verify deploy state directly in the pipeline console, documented at the page below.

runbook for kahop-kajop: https://rundeck.ordinio.test/display/secrets/pipeline/issue/pages/repo/browse/e5732776e07d1285107e5aeb

Meeting notes, records team, Monday. Off-site backup tapes for the Larkbourne archive rotate this Friday. Six tapes go out, six return; Priya will verify serials against the rotation sheet. Storage vendor is Cobbleston Vaults; their courier arrives before noon. Sheet must be signed on both legs. The confidential courier hand-over instruction appears directly below.

courier memo of yagug-fahip: the pelys tameth courier leaves the silys ledger at gate 7827 under passcode 926220